The LEXO is a stationary, end-effector-based robotic gait rehabilitation system developed by the Austrian neurotechnology pioneer Tyromotion GmbH. Unlike traditional exoskeleton systems that bind the entire leg to a rigid frame, an end-effector system guides the patient's feet via moving robotic footplates.
